Back-end software engineering
is a crucial aspect of modern web development, focusing on the server-side logic and database integration. This field involves designing, building, and maintaining complex systems that power online applications and services.
Developing skills in back-end software engineering enables you to create scalable, secure, and efficient systems that meet the demands of today's digital landscape.
With a Certificate in Back-end Software Engineering, you'll gain hands-on experience in programming languages such as Java, Python, and C++, as well as frameworks like Node.js and Django.
Learn from industry experts and apply your knowledge to real-world projects, preparing you for a career in back-end development.
Take the first step towards a successful career in back-end software engineering and explore this certificate program today!
Benefits of studying Certificate in Back-End Software Engineering
Back-End Software Engineering has become a highly sought-after skill in today's market, with the UK job market witnessing a significant increase in demand for professionals with expertise in this field. According to a report by the UK's National Careers Service, the number of job postings for back-end developers has risen by 22% in the past year alone.
| Year |
Number of Job Postings |
| 2020 |
15,600 |
| 2021 |
19,200 |
| 2022 |
22,800 |
Learn key facts about Certificate in Back-End Software Engineering
The Certificate in Back-End Software Engineering is a comprehensive program designed to equip students with the necessary skills and knowledge to excel in the field of back-end software development.
This certificate program focuses on teaching students the fundamentals of back-end software engineering, including data structures, algorithms, computer systems, and software design patterns.
Upon completion of the program, students will be able to design, develop, and deploy scalable and secure back-end systems, utilizing programming languages such as Java, Python, and C++.
The learning outcomes of this certificate program include the ability to analyze complex problems, design efficient solutions, and implement them using various programming languages and technologies.
The duration of the Certificate in Back-End Software Engineering varies depending on the institution offering the program, but it typically takes several months to a year to complete.
The industry relevance of this certificate is high, as back-end software engineers are in high demand across various industries, including finance, healthcare, and e-commerce.
Many companies, such as Amazon, Google, and Microsoft, require back-end software engineers to design and develop scalable and secure systems, making this certificate highly valuable in the job market.
The skills gained from this certificate program can be applied to a wide range of roles, including back-end developer, software engineer, and technical lead, making it an excellent choice for those looking to transition into a career in back-end software engineering.
Overall, the Certificate in Back-End Software Engineering is a great option for individuals looking to acquire the skills and knowledge necessary to succeed in this field.
Who is Certificate in Back-End Software Engineering for?
| Ideal Audience for Certificate in Back-End Software Engineering |
Are you a UK-based individual looking to kickstart a career in software engineering? |
| Age: |
Typically, our students are between 18 and 30 years old, with many having prior experience in IT or related fields. |
| Background: |
No prior experience is necessary, but having a basic understanding of programming concepts and software development principles is beneficial. |
| Career Goals: |
Our students aim to secure roles in back-end software engineering, such as junior developer, software engineer, or back-end developer, with average salaries ranging from £25,000 to £40,000 per annum in the UK. |
| Education Level: |
GCSEs or equivalent, with a strong focus on mathematics and computer science. |
| Personality Traits: |
Our students are curious, motivated, and enjoy problem-solving. They are also willing to learn and adapt to new technologies and techniques. |